Product Description

by Andrew D. Turner (Editor), Megan E. O'Neil (Editor), Miruna Achim (Contribution by)

The untold chronicles of the looting and collecting of ancient Mesoamerican objects.

Author Biography

Andrew D. Turner is a senior research specialist at the Getty Research Institute.

Megan E. O'Neil is assistant professor of art history at Emory University and faculty curator at the Carlos Museum.
